Father’s Favorite Sayings

1. The man on the top of the mountain didn’t fall there. - Joe Kosanovic’s Dad

2. Never underestimate the power of human stupidity. - Rich Constand’s Dad

3. Marry a big woman; someone to give you shade in the summer and warmth in the winter. - Bill Bodin’s Dad

4. An excuse is a poor patch for the garment of failure. - Bruce Ley’s Dad

5. Never try to catch two frogs with one hand. - Rea Hunt’s Dad

6. Always throw away the box when you take the last piece of candy. - Paul Whalen’s Dad

7. Honesty is like a trail, once you get off it you realize you are lost. - Mark Young’s Dad

8. Remember who you are and where you came from. - Thomas Leone’s Dad

9. Wherever you are in life, first make friends with the cook. - Bill Lewis’s Dad

10. Don’t shake the tree too hard, you never know what might fall out. - Timothy Davis’s Dad

11. A closed mouth gathers no feet. - John Beard, Jr.’s Dad

12. Measure twice, cut once. - Sandra Schultz’s Dad

13. The second time you get kicked in the head by a mule it’s not a learning experience. - Ebb Dozier, Jr.’s Dad

14. Never buy anything that eats. - Neal Bashor’s Dad

15. You need to do what you have to do before you can do what you want to do. - Reed Caster’s Dad

16. Well, you know what happens when you wrestle with pigs, you get all dirty and they love it. - Dennie Morgan’s Dad

17. This is a democratic family; everyone gets a vote and I get five. - Carolee Wende’s Dad

18. I buy you books and buy you books, and all you do is read the covers. - Kelley Blaner’s Dad

19. If you’re afraid to go too far, you will never go far enough. - Kasey Warner’s Dad

20. If you don’t need it, don’t buy it. - Nicholas Pieroni’s Dad

21. Selling is just like shaving, if you don’t do it every day you’re a bum. - Mark Johnson’s Dad

22. If this is the worst thing that happens to you in life, don’t worry about it. - John Taylor’s Dad

23. Never be so broke that you cannot afford to pay attention. - Michael Brose’s Dad

24. You live to work, you work to live, but if you work to work, I hope you don’t live by me. - Cole Thurman’s Dad

25. If it is to be, it’s up to me. - Jeff Wilson’s Dad

26. Successful people make a habit of doing things that failures don’t like to do. - Charles H. Deal, Jr.’s Dad

27. Don’t let your studies interfere with your education. - Eber Smith’s Dad

28. Don’t be foolish just because you know how to. - Maynard Alfstad’s Dad

29. Marry your best friend. - Patrice Altenhofen’s Dad

30. Peer pressure is a crack in the armor of your own conviction. - Peter W. Troy’s Dad

31. Knowing what’s right from wrong is education, doing what’s right is execution. The latter is the hard part. - Bambi Troy’s Dad

32. The difference always is attitude. - Suzie Slater’s Dad

33. You have to eat an elephant in small bites - John Burke’s Dad

34. The one who quits last—wins. - Paul Gesl’s Dad

35. Potential means you haven’t done your best yet. - Melissa and Nicholas West’s Dad

36. Do you know what happened when I found out all the answers? They changed all the questions. - Carmella Leone’s Dad

37. The golden rule: the guy who’s got the gold makes the rules. - Paul Wagner’s Dad

38. If everybody else is doing it, it is probably wrong. - Karl K. Warner’s Dad

From U.S.A. Today, Monday, June 15, p. 11c.
